Aïn Kechba
Aïn Kechba is a spring in Medea Province, Algeria and has an elevation of 918 metres. Aïn Kechba is situated nearby to the locality Domaine Boubakeur, as well as near Ouled Salah.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Ouled Deide is a town and commune in Médéa Province, Algeria. According to the 1998 census, it has a population of 4,770. Ouled Deide is situated 6 km east of Aïn Kechba.

Zoubiria is a town and commune in Médéa Province, Algeria. According to the 1998 census, it has a population of 15,009. Zoubiria is situated 7 km southwest of Aïn Kechba.
